For a country that has only nine million people, it is extraordinary that it is able to sustain two automakers. The nation is Sweden while the two corporations are Saab and Volvo. Volvo, that's owned by Ford Motor Company, has had the greatest influence on the car industry. Their biggest impact on the industry has been in the area of safety features. Some of the things that had their roots with Volvo, are reinforced roofs, front end crumple zones, and specifically created interiors. With their high standards for safety, Volvo built a reputation for building great solid cars. It was by means of their leadership that caused automakers around the world to raise their standards, also.


The Volkswagen Beetle is a car that just about everyone knows about although not so much regarding the history behind the car. The Beetle primarily came out through the 1930's in Germany as the "people's car." Immediately after World War II, it had the reputation of being among the best loved cars and one of the most mass-produced cars ever. The Beetle permitted individuals from every walk of life to have a car. Any individual, whether they happened to be college students, farmers or business people, could drive a Beetle. The Beetle continued to be fashionable in the United States until finally Volkswagen stopped importing them in the 1970's however they continued to be produced in Mexico until the the first half of the 2000's.

When Audi first introduced the all wheel drive Quattro, it was the first of its kind. Audi took the automobile community by storm and fixed the bar high for other luxury automakers. Their Quattro technology put them forward of the competitors for years. Their traction and road handling was so considerably advanced in comparison to the competition, that the cars were not allowed in specific racing competitions.
